  • Creates a new option set from the given raw value.

    This initializer always succeeds, even if the value passed as rawValue exceeds the static properties declared as part of the option set. This example creates an instance of ShippingOptions with a raw value beyond the highest element, with a bit mask that effectively contains all the declared static members.

    let extraOptions = ShippingOptions(rawValue: 255)
    print(extraOptions.isStrictSuperset(of: .all))
    // Prints "true"
    

    Declaration

    Swift

    init(rawValue: UInt32)

    Parameters

    rawValue

    The raw value of the option set to create. Each bit of rawValue potentially represents an element of the option set, though raw values may include bits that are not defined as distinct values of the OptionSet type.
